Welcome to Resіdenсe 7Α at 175 Wеѕt 93rd Ѕtreet, a spасіοus аnd well-appointed three-bedroom, two-bathroom home offering excellent closet space, an in-unit washer/dryer, and classic pre-war details, including beamed ceilings. Located within The Westwind, a distinguished pre-war cooperative designed by renowned architect Rosario Candela, the residence benefits from the timeless appeal and thoughtful design for which his buildings are known. The living area provides comfortable space for everyday living and entertaining, while the three-bedroom layout easily accommodates guests, a home office, or changing household needs. Two full bathrooms and abundant storage further enhance the home's practicality and appeal. Residents of The Westwind enjoy a full complement of building amenities, including a 24-hour doorman, live-in super, laundry facilities, and bike storage. The Westwind combines classic pre-war architecture with an exceptional Upper West Side location. Trader Joe's is located on the corner, Whole Foods is nearby, and the neighborhood offers an outstanding selection of restaurants, cafés, specialty food shops, and everyday conveniences. The 1, 2, and 3 subway lines are just moments away, providing convenient access throughout Manhattan. Central Park and Riverside Park are both nearby, offering some of the city's finest green spaces, recreational opportunities, and waterfront paths. Please note: there is an ongoing capital improvement monthly assessment of $234.61 allocated to this unit. Some of the images are virtually staged.
